Dirty Dancing is well known for having the very popular phrase “Nobody puts Baby in a corner”.  This film is set in the early 60’s in a holiday resort in New York’s Catskill Mountains.  The ‘Houseman’ family travel to the holiday resort to enjoy a relaxing holiday.  The Houseman’s youngest daughter Frances “Baby” Houseman (Jennifer Grey) is a smart young girl and her father has high expectations for her to go to college and save the world before marrying a doctor, just like he is.

 
Baby and her older sister Lisa (Jane Brucker) do not get along very well and the holiday resort is mostly full of older guests so Baby gets bored and decides to go for a walk.  Baby hears lots of music and noise coming from the employee’s dorm.  While walking up to the party she meets a man carrying lots of watermelons, so she offers to help him.  They then go into the party where Baby is surrounded by lots of employees dancing exotically in particular Johnny (Patrick Swayze) and Penny (Cynthia Rodes).  Baby is memorised by Johnny and falls for him and wants to be around him all the time. 


Penny finds out she is pregnant so she can no longer be Johnny’s dance partner.  Baby then offers to step in and learn the routine so Johnny can still do his routine at a local hotel which they do every year.  Baby does not tell her family she has been dancing with Johnny as her father would not approve.  Meanwhile Penny is trying to gather money for an abortion, Baby then goes to her father and asks for money to help her friend but does not tell her father what it is for.  Baby gets the money so Penny gets the abortion but there is problems with the procedure so Baby gets her father to come and help Penny since he is a doctor. 

Johnny and Baby get closer and end up falling in love.  They continue dancing together and Baby becomes a really good dancer.  They perform at the hotel and when they come back they see Penny is in trouble.  Baby’s dad thinks Johnny is the one who got Penny pregnant so he thinks he is nothing but trouble and warns his daughter to stay away from him.  Johnny gets sacked from the holiday resort after he is accused of stealing a wallet between 1.30 am and 4.00am.  Baby knows that Johnny did not steal the wallet and she was with him the whole night.  Baby’s father is angry when he finds this out and he decides the family are leaving the resort.

Johnny and Baby have an emotional goodbye as Johnny has to leave the camp. At the end of the show, Johnny also does the last dance of the season but this year he got told it was changed and he wasn’t to do the end show anymore.  Lisa is in the end of the show signing and Baby and her mum and dad are sitting at a table watching.  Johnny then walks through the door and walks up to Baby’s table and says “Nobody puts Baby in a corner”.  Johnny and Baby then continue to do the last dance of the season and Baby’s dad realises he was wrong about Johnny.  In the end everyone is up dancing and enjoying themselves.
